2017 NCSF Morning Specialty

Thank you to everyone who contributed their time and efforts to the 2017 NCSF Dual Specialty Shows! Our club drew entries from all over the Western US, even as far as Alaska. The weather was hot, and the sun and spirits were cheery.

Despite the heat, exhibitors and club members took to the ring bright and early to show sweepstakes entries to Dr Darin Collins, and regular class entries to breeder judge Eric Steel.

Everyone loved the painted glass morning trophies from artist Val Hiller, and the afternoon portraits from artist Elle Wilson.

All the dogs showed beautifully and the judges had a difficult time choosing which dogs to present with ribbons.

Eric Steel awarded Morning Best of Breed to AmGCh CanCh Kushiel’s To Solace My Heart SC, Envy, a female fawn with sable feathering. Afternoon judge, Lois Ann Snyder, awarded Afternoon Best of Breed to GCh Scimitar’s Arctic Hurricane, Cane, a feathered male golden. Congratulations to Envy and Cane and all the winners!

After a fun day of showing, exhibitors gathered together to celebrate the day with wine and cheese, and of course, raffle drawings and a lively auction! Thank you to everyone who came, we love hosting this event!
